create react app build 之后空白 (无报错)

2,281 阅读1分钟

有报错情况

也有可能打开build后的index.html 后发现报错一片空白。 看报错信息是路径不对的话。

在package.json里添加homepage

 "name": "h5",
"version": "0.1.0",
"private": true,
"homepage": "./", //add this line
"dependencies": {

无报错情况

查看项目路由使用的是不是 createBrowserHistory 如果是的话改为createHashHistory即可正常打开。

如果要使用createBrowserHistory打开的话需要:

用根路径打开改文件,使用nginx代理转发即可